About the Fishing Bridge
Fishing Bridge, located in Cody, Wyoming, United States, is a historic tourist attraction with a rich history dating back to 1902. The existing bridge, built in 1937, was once a popular fishing spot for cutthroat trout, but was closed to fishing in 1973 due to population decline. The area is also known for its large volcanic eruptions, including one that formed the Yellowstone caldera and Yellowstone Lake. Visitors can explore nearby attractions such as Mud Volcano, Hayden Valley, and the Natural Bridge, while staying overnight at lodges or campgrounds in the area. Wildlife enthusiasts will enjoy spotting bears, bison, elk, and other animals in the diverse ecosystems surrounding Fishing Bridge.
